From Beginner to Pro: Steps to Take When Starting Forex Trading

From Beginner to Pro: Steps to Take When Starting Forex Trading

Forex trading, also known as foreign exchange trading, has gained immense popularity over the years. With its potential for high profits and accessibility from anywhere in the world, it has become an attractive venture for individuals seeking financial independence. However, it is crucial to understand that forex trading is not a get-rich-quick scheme. It requires time, effort, and a strong foundation of knowledge to succeed. In this article, we will guide you through the steps to take when starting forex trading, from beginner to pro.

Step 1: Educate Yourself

The first and most important step when starting forex trading is to educate yourself about the market. Forex trading involves buying and selling currency pairs, aiming to profit from the fluctuations in their exchange rates. Familiarize yourself with the basic concepts, such as pips, lots, leverage, and margin, as well as the different types of analysis, such as technical and fundamental analysis. There are numerous educational resources available online, including tutorials, books, webinars, and courses. Take advantage of these resources to develop a solid understanding of forex trading.

Step 2: Choose a Reliable Broker

Selecting a reliable forex broker is essential for your success as a trader. A good broker should offer a user-friendly trading platform, competitive spreads, fast execution, and a wide range of trading instruments. Additionally, ensure that the broker is regulated by a reputable financial authority to protect your funds and ensure fair trading conditions. Take your time to research different brokers, compare their features and reviews, and choose the one that best suits your trading needs.

Step 3: Practice with a Demo Account

Before risking real money, it is crucial to practice trading with a demo account. Most reputable brokers offer demo accounts with virtual funds, allowing you to simulate real trading conditions without any financial risk. Utilize this opportunity to familiarize yourself with the trading platform, test different strategies, and gain hands-on experience without the fear of losing money. Treat the demo account seriously, as it will help you build confidence and develop your trading skills.

Step 4: Develop a Trading Plan

A trading plan is a written document that outlines your trading goals, strategies, risk management rules, and trading schedule. It acts as a roadmap for your trading journey and keeps you disciplined and focused. Your trading plan should include your preferred trading style (such as day trading or swing trading), the currency pairs you will focus on, and the indicators or tools you will use for analysis. Additionally, define your risk tolerance and set realistic profit targets. Regularly review and update your trading plan as you gain more experience and adapt to market conditions.

Step 5: Start Small and Gradually Increase Your Position Size

When you start trading with real money, it is essential to start small and gradually increase your position size as you gain confidence and experience. This approach allows you to manage your risks effectively and avoid significant losses in the early stages of your trading journey. Implement proper risk management techniques, such as setting stop-loss orders and never risking more than a certain percentage of your trading capital on a single trade. Remember, preserving your capital is crucial for long-term success in forex trading.

Step 6: Continuously Learn and Adapt

Forex trading is a dynamic and ever-changing market. To stay ahead, it is essential to continuously learn and adapt. Stay updated with economic news, market trends, and geopolitical events that can impact currency movements. Follow reputable financial news websites, attend webinars, and join online trading communities to gain insights from experienced traders. Additionally, keep a trading journal to track your trades, identify patterns, and learn from both your successes and failures. By continuously learning and adapting, you can refine your trading strategies and improve your profitability.

Step 7: Seek Professional Guidance

As you progress in your forex trading journey, consider seeking professional guidance. Experienced mentors or trading coaches can provide valuable insights, help you avoid common pitfalls, and accelerate your learning curve. They can also provide personalized feedback on your trading strategies and offer guidance on risk management and psychological aspects of trading. Investing in professional guidance can save you time and money in the long run.

In conclusion, starting forex trading requires a solid foundation of knowledge, a reliable broker, practice with a demo account, a well-defined trading plan, effective risk management, continuous learning, and potentially seeking professional guidance. By following these steps, you can transition from a beginner to a pro trader and increase your chances of success in the forex market. Remember, patience, discipline, and perseverance are key traits for achieving long-term profitability in forex trading.
